The Black Power slogan, Part 1

The slogan "Black Power" transformed the struggle for civil rights into an anti-imperialist movement.
Part 1: In this first part, Chairman Omali Yeshitela explains the material basis which gave rise to the emergence of the black civil rights movement in the fifties. This movement adopted the philosophy of non violence in face of the North American government's violence in Korea, Vietnam , Cuba and elsewhere.

Also discussed is the role of young people in the mobilisation of African people in the U.S.
